Baal Zephon

Description

Baal Zephon is a biblical term with various meanings and significant historical and religious relevance. It is mentioned in the Hebrew Bible and is believed to refer to a place or a deity worshiped during ancient times.

Sense 1: Place

In the Book of Exodus, Baal Zephon is thought to be the name of a location where the Israelites camped during their escape from Egypt. Some scholars suggest that it might have been a prominent landmark or a specific region in the area.

Sense 2: Deity

Baal Zephon is also believed to be a god or a representation of a divine entity worshiped in ancient Near Eastern cultures. The exact nature and characteristics of this deity are subject to debate among historians and theologians.
